Field Service Technician - Construction Equipment
Field Service Technicians are responsible for preventive maintenance, diagnostics, repair, and service of Caterpillar diesel powered construction equipment. This is a skilled field service mechanic position working largely independently and out of a company-provided field service truck, performing at a variety of customer locations and service shops. A Field Service Technician reports to a Branch Manager, and serves customers typically located throughout the region.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ities- Read and interpret technical instructions, safety manuals, service manuals, company policies and procedures.
- Work with electric/electronic and hydraulic system schematics, wiring diagrams, and equipment service manuals, and be proficient in the use of test equipment.
- Provide advanced troubleshooting and high-quality repair service on construction equipment, engines, and power trains to respond to customer needs in a positive, safe, and timely manner, ensuring maximum value.
- Identify, troubleshoot, diagnose, and provide quality repairs of Caterpillar equipment and related engine mechanical systems; act as technical expert and primary support contact, communicating with customers to provide an exceptional customer experience.
- Travel within an assigned region and work overtime, weekends, and/or holidays, sometimes with short notice; overnight travel may occasionally be required (averaging up to 25%).
- Possess and maintain a current, valid state driver's license and current DOT medical card required for operating service trucks and for towing.
- Have a basic set of industrial tools, including industrial hand tools, air tools, torque wrenches, and multimeters.
- Work flexible schedules, including nights, weekends and on-call hours as required, and work independently in remote locations.
- Work in an environment where hazards are present.
- Use frequent hand use for typing, operating the phone, handling materials, and other job-related tasks.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
- Field Service Technician training and/or equipment service and maintenance training through accredited technical schools, equipment dealerships or manufacturer training preferred. High school diploma required.
- Five (5) or more years' experience with equipment diagnostics and advanced troubleshooting on construction equipment. Candidates with limited equipment experience, but with strong engine experience will be considered.
